1505 West HWY 290, Dripping Springs, TX 78620 Position Summary Avir at Dripping Springs is seeking motivated and compassionate Certified Occupational Therapist Assistants (COTA) to join our in-house subacute rehabilitation program within a skilled nursing facility setting. Positions are available for both full-time and per diem schedules. The COTA will work under the supervision of a licensed Occupational Therapist to provide high-quality, patient-centered occupational therapy services focused on subacute rehabilitation, functional recovery, and successful transition of patients back to their highest level of independence. Key Responsibilities The Certified Occupational Therapist Assistant will implement individualized occupational therapy treatment plans developed by the Occupational Therapist, focusing on improving patients' ability to perform activities of daily living (ADLs), mobility tasks, and functional skills. Responsibilities include providing hands-on therapy interventions, documenting patient progress accurately and timely, and communicating effectively with the supervising OT and interdisciplinary care team. The COTA will contribute to discharge planning and collaborate with nursing, therapy staff (PT, PTA, OT, SLP), and physicians to support coordinated patient care and optimal rehabilitation outcomes. Additional responsibilities include maintaining productivity standards, ensuring compliance with facility policies and regulatory requirements, and supporting a safe and therapeutic environment for patients in the subacute setting. Qualifications Active Certified Occupational Therapist Assistant (COTA) license in the state of Texas (required) Graduate of an accredited Occupational Therapy Assistant program Experience in skilled nursing or subacute rehabilitation preferred, but not required Strong communication and teamwork skills Ability to follow clinical direction and work collaboratively within an interdisciplinary team Commitment to patient-centered care and functional recovery Core Competencies Clinical implementation of occupational therapy treatment plans Patient-centered care in subacute rehabilitation Strong communication with OT and interdisciplinary teams Documentation accuracy and compliance Team collaboration (PT/OT/SLP integration) Compassionate and hands-on therapeutic care delivery Work Environment This position is based in an in-house subacute rehabilitation program within a skilled nursing facility . The COTA will work closely with licensed therapists, nursing staff, and physicians to support patient recovery and functional improvement. Scheduling may vary based on full-time or per diem availability , and flexibility is appreciated based on patient needs and facility census.
